The estate had actually belonged to a William Lawrence, who owed 7000 to Robert Claxton and Son.




He paid the financial obligation by providing the estate to the Claxtons until he might pay the money. Claxton passed estate to William Weare of Abbots Leigh, Bristol, to pay off 10,000 financing which he owed to Weare. G. W. Braikenridge had been the mortgagee of the estate in 1818. The deeds likewise include copies of a number in indentures at various days and details concerning 45 acres of land purchased from the Pinney household. The Hale Legacy held by Bristol Document Office consists of material from the Braikenridge family members. Paints notes Braikenridge a customer of the Bristol Institution of artists. Central to his collection was a duplicate of William Barrett, Background and Classical Times of the City of Bristol and a collection of more than ... V & A: Furnishings and Woodwork keeps in mind Fellow Other Church [Constructed] summary Braikenridge was the largest solitary benefactor in the structure of the church, which was consecrated in 1839. In middle ages England, St Anne, a somewhat apocraphyl saint, said to be the mother of Mary, was extensively celebrated. On the borders of contemporary Bristol is one antique from now. St. Anne's Well is possibly all that is left of a bigger site, that included a kept in mind chapel without a doubt it is the church which has an older more venerable history. Currently the church appears have actually neglected the well, but not the citizens that each Saturday local to the old saint's feast day enter procession to the well. The present party of this noteddivine well is probably more of a contrived custom than revived perhaps but although it is mostly removed of its spiritual emphasis is no less considerable. Nevertheless, initial' contemporary 'processions to the well begun in 1880s with the start of local Catholic attendance. In 1927 the Reverend C F. Harman lead the very first twentieth century procession to the well and held a service there because of this it came to be a yearly event only declining evidently in the 1970s as the website became vandalised and gradually derelict. After that the procession was led by country Dean Daddy John Bradley that according to Ken Taylor's 2016 work with the well and chapel, The Holy Wells and Chapel of St Anne in the Wood, Brislington, Bristol:" snaked through St. Anne's Timber tothe holy well where a solution was held collectively with the Rev. Leaving the pub at 2.15 pm the group adhered to as very closely as feasible the course of Brislington Brook, which caused the so called Pilgrim's Path through stunning Nightingale Valley. They got to the holy well at St. Anne's Wood around 3pm
, where numerous other individuals waited the arrival of the celebration." A more stroll happened a year later or so on Sunday 25th for Festival of British Archaeology therefore the numbers dual and at the well More hints they added:" more bows, pendants and other keepsakes currently there." By the list below year, the procession had expanded to around a hundred and the procession having actually members spruced up especially in medieval outfits. These royal personages being welcomed by the Lord of Mayor of Bristol, who was likewise the councillor for Brislington. This year additionally presented a few of the more theatrical aspects of the stroll, concerning a loads monologues created particularly by neighborhood individuals for the occasion read along the route and close to the well.

The site is bounded by public roadways, with Bath Roadway developing the southerly border, Ironmould Lane developing the eastern and northern limits , and Broomhill Road and Emery Roadway creating the western boundary. The north, eastern, and west borders are noted by high rock walls, while the south limit is enclosed by C20 wire fences. The entrance exists in the direction of the centre of the southern limit. It is marked by a pair of high, square-section ashlar piers, where reduced quadrant wall surfaces expand back to a pair of reduced, square-section stone piers with domed caps which frame the entryway to the drive.
